The Annamacharya Institute of Technology and Sciences (AITS), Kadapa, is affiliated with JNTU Anantapur and AICTE-approved. It offers a well-structured B.Tech in CSE programme emphasizing programming, AI, and software development. Admission is based on Andhra Pradesh EAMCET scores, with management quota options available. The college provides modern infrastructure, has a strong placement record (notable for IT roles), and is positively rated for campus facilities. The approximate fee for the programme is ?3.02 lakhs.

Annamacharya Institute of Technology and Sciences (AITS) offers strong placement opportunities with average salary packages of around INR 4 LPA and the highest reaching up to INR 30 LPA. The lowest package stands at INR 1.2 LPA. Companies like Google, Amazon, Infosys, and Wipro recruit from the institute. Roles offered include software engineer, data scientist, and product manager. The placement cell organizes soft skills training, workshops, and company-specific training to enhance students' employability.
